Christmas Spectacular 2024: Celebrating the Joy of the Season
Date: 21 December 2024
The Literary and Cultural Association of Kristu Jayanti (Deemed to be University) celebrated the festive spirit of Christmas with Christmas Spectacular 2024 on 21st December at the Jubilee Auditorium. The event brought together students, faculty, and staff, creating an atmosphere filled with warmth, joy, and togetherness.

The celebration was graced by the Chief Guest, Fr. Prashant Madtha S J, whose inspiring presence added great value to the occasion. The program featured a captivating Christmas play, vibrant dance performances, and melodious carol singing by the students. Each performance beautifully reflected the true essence of Christmas, spreading festive cheer and uniting the Jayantian family.

The event was also honored by the presence of distinguished dignitaries including Rev. Fr. Dr. Augustine George, Fr. Dr. Lijo P. Thomas, Fr. Emmanuel P.J., Fr. Jais V. Thomas, and Fr. Deepu Joy.

Faculty members, postgraduate students, students from the Law College, and administrative staff actively participated, making the celebration a memorable gathering filled with joy and festive spirit.


Once Upon A Tune 2020: A Musical of Hope
Date: 18 December 2020
The Christmas celebration titled Once Upon A Tune was held on 18th December 2020 as a musical production by the Kristu Jayanti College Choir, centered around the theme “Hope is Born.”

The program creatively narrated the story of a young child encountering Santa Claus and rediscovering the magic of Christmas through music and memories. The performances filled the audience with a sense of hope and joy during a challenging time.

Fr. James Narithooki delivered a heartfelt Christmas message, encouraging everyone to become messengers of peace and work together towards a better world.

Rev. Fr. Dr. Augustine George also addressed the gathering, emphasizing the values of hope, love, and thoughtfulness during the festive season.

Despite the pandemic, the celebration reached a global audience, with thousands tuning in via YouTube Live, making it a truly inclusive and uplifting event.


Once Upon A Tune 2019: Exploring the “Love Theory”
Date: 18 December 2019
The 2019 edition of Once Upon A Tune was held at the S.K.E Auditorium with the theme “Love Theory.” The event showcased a harmonious blend of music and storytelling, encouraging the audience to reflect on the deeper meaning of love.

The Jayantian Choir, led by Mr. Prujeeth Joshua, presented a series of soulful performances including classics like “God Rest Ye Merry Gentlemen,” “Silent Night,” and “Feliz Navidad.”

The songs were seamlessly interwoven with a student-written and directed skit, creating a meaningful and engaging experience for the audience.


Once Upon A Tune 2018: Joy to the World
Date: 19th December, 2018
The 2018 edition of Once Upon A Tune was organized with the theme “Joy to the World.” Held at the SKE Auditorium, the program featured two shows and brought together music, dance, and theatre in a vibrant celebration.

The storyline followed a young student’s journey of discovering joy amidst loneliness, beautifully complemented by popular Christmas carols such as “Silent Night,” “Hark the Herald Angels Sing,” and “Joy to the World.”

Rev. Fr. Augustine George and Rev. Fr. Josekutty P.D shared meaningful messages highlighting the importance of love, compassion, and the true spirit of Christmas.

The celebration stood as a lively and heartfelt expression of unity, joy, and festive cheer on campus.
